For reference: Even if you have just 1 production line for each item, filling that takes just under 4 hours. 😂 during which you can do other stuff like cleaning up other parts of your factory, improving your power grid or go exploring for resources and upgrades. Thta's the beauty of automation. 😊

Right now I am in the process of building a gigantic double carousel manufactory. Basically a sushi belt carousel loop with another carousel loop inside of it, with mergers and smart splitters splitting off each one to other manufactory modules up and down the length of the carousel. Each floor has five manufactories processing a single item type on each side, and three walls up, another floor starts, with the carousel loops stacked in the middle. It's not efficient, but as I keep going, it is at the very least interesting.

Rubber and plastic are of course being processed elsewhere, but only in the capacity of the fact that I obviously can't do them in the same manufactory unless I want to pipe oil across the map and I really don't want to.
